Ticket: Staging env misconfigured for Siftgate bloom filter

The bloom layer in front of the Pellet KV store is rejecting all lookups in staging because the env file was copied from the dev template without credentials. False-positive tuning values are fine; only the auth line is missing. To unblock the weekly demo, the Pellet admission secret must be set on the following line.

env line for yaguf-fajop: LEDGER_TOKEN13=fb08984397349

Management Meeting Minutes — Reseller Programme

Present: Dena Forsgate, Ollie Rennick, Priya Calloway.

Quick recap: the Fernlight reseller programme is tracking ahead of plan — 14 partners signed versus the 10 we'd hoped for. Margins are a bit thinner than modelled, mostly down to the tiered discount we offered early joiners. Ollie will tighten the discount bands before the next intake. Where we want to take the programme next is covered in the note below.

board note of yahip-tadug: Headcount on the Zorath team goes from 9 to 100 by the end of April. Gross margin on Zorath came in at 10 percent against a plan of 20 percent.

Handover note — Quillpay retries. The idempotency-key middleware is live on the charge and refund endpoints; keys are derived from merchant reference plus attempt window and stored in Corvid cache for 48 hours. Remaining work: extend coverage to payout retries and add metrics for duplicate suppression. The rollout flag is off in production pending the next release train. For scheduling the enablement and any rollback decisions, the release manager should coordinate with the engineer named below.

named custodian: Brivan Eliath Quenox Frador